What is Georgetown University in Qatar? Exploring the University
Georgetown University in Qatar (GU-Q), as its name suggests, is a branch campus of the prestigious Georgetown University in Washington, D.C. It’s located in Education City, Doha, Qatar. GU-Q was established in 2005, a collaboration between Georgetown University and the Qatar Foundation. GU-Q offers the same rigorous curriculum and academic standards as its main campus, but with a unique focus on international affairs and global issues, specifically relevant to the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region. Academic Programs at Georgetown Qatar: What Can You Study?
Alright, let's get into the nitty-gritty of what you can actually study at GU-Q. The campus offers four undergraduate degree programs, all leading to a Bachelor of Science in Foreign Service (BSFS) degree. This is a big deal, guys! The BSFS is the flagship degree of Georgetown's School of Foreign Service, and it’s known worldwide for its academic excellence.
